Sixty-year-old Ultramarathon Winner Publishes Inspiring Autobiography
Hong Kong (PRWEB) September 20, 2013 -- Jan Abbott has proven again that it is never too late to fulfill one’s dream. Abbott started marathon running at the age of 56, ran three London marathons, and then won a 60-kilometre, three-day ultramarathon event in China, just a couple of weeks short of her 60th birthday – a remarkably unprecedented feat. She knows full well that her running, and the fundraising that went alongside it, has inspired many people. Now, she details her breathtaking journey toward her dreams in her newly published book: "Never Too Late."

About the Author
Jan Abbott was born in Yorkshire, England and lives with her husband in Hong Kong. They have four children, five grandchildren and counting. She is a retired teacher with a passion for children, travel and adventure and has had a lifelong interest in sport and fitness. She is currently working on a children’s book, titled "Through The Mist."
